## Runbook: Draining the Osterwick transcode farm

Before draining any node in the Osterwick farm, confirm no active jobs remain in the Pellenshaw queue; a forced drain corrupts partially written segments and the cleanup is manual. Drain nodes one at a time, waiting for the health check to go green between each. Keep at least four encoders live during business hours. The farm's standing configuration values appear below.

config for tagep-yajef:
ulawyn:
  log_level: error
  metrics_host: metrics.ulawyn.lumiclabs.internal
  pin: 0564
  pool_size: 32

## Support

SproutTimer is the plant-watering scheduler used by the Greenbay household apps. Support handles three common issues: missed watering notifications, timezone drift after travel, and duplicate schedules from re-paired hubs. Check the diagnostics panel first; it surfaces the last sync timestamp and pending jobs. Known bugs and workarounds live in the internal tracker under the SproutTimer component. If a case falls outside documented fixes or involves data loss, escalate it to the engineering rotation at the address below.

escalation mailbox, bafog-fafog: ulador@paliqlabs.internal

## Runbook: TallyTrove ledger stalls

If the TallyTrove loyalty-points ledger stops posting accruals, check the consumer lag dashboard first. Lag over five minutes means the partition writer is wedged; restart it. Never replay events without snapshotting balances. Escalate if checksums diverge after restart. Before restarting, confirm the service is running with the expected configuration values shown below.

service settings:
PRAIX_LOG_LEVEL=error
PRAIX_METRICS_HOST=metrics.praix.qorvelcorp.corp
PRAIX_POOL_SIZE=16

TURN-208: Gatevale turnstile counters at the Merrow Field pilot double-count when a rotation reverses mid-cycle. Attendance totals drift roughly 2% high per event. The debounce window fix is implemented, reviewed by Ilsa, and soak-tested across two simulated match days without drift. Ready for your cut; the candidate build is identified below.

trace token, tagag-tafog: htk6_5ed18c